Output 037abba2ab4fbfcb91b7a7c7a7271daadee36d6ae16b9fe0fa315fcfca92c4cb:17

value
299062
script pubkey
OP_0 OP_PUSHBYTES_20 d3ef4420a74bdc5a188350c72475e5e31245970a
address
bc1q60h5gg98f0w95xyr2rrjga09uvfyt9c2q8pdfx
transaction
037abba2ab4fbfcb91b7a7c7a7271daadee36d6ae16b9fe0fa315fcfca92c4cb
spent
true